About Marie Stopes Zambia (MSZ)

Marie Stopes Zambia (MSZ), part of the global MSI Reproductive Choices network, is a leading social enterprise delivering high-quality family planning and reproductive health services. Our mission is to ensure that individuals can have children by choice, not by chance.

We are seeking a dynamic and experienced Technical Advisor – Youth, Disability & Gender Inclusion to provide strategic leadership and technical oversight for initiatives that promote equitable access to sexual and reproductive health (SRH) services for adolescents, young people, women, men, and persons with disabilities.

About the Role

Reporting to the Operations Director, you will lead the development and implementation of innovative, inclusive, and gender-transformative strategies across service delivery channels. You will play a pivotal role in ensuring that youth, disability, and gender considerations are effectively integrated into programmes, policies, and service delivery approaches.

The successful candidate will work closely with internal teams, government institutions, development partners, civil society organizations, and disability-focused organizations to strengthen access to quality SRH services and contribute to organisational growth and impact.

Job Requirements

Qualifications and Experience

Essential

  • Bachelor's Degree in Social Sciences, Health Sciences, Public Health, Development Studies, or a related field.
  • Demonstrated experience in a leadership or technical advisory role.
  • Experience in strategic planning and programme implementation.
  • Proven experience in youth-friendly programming and service design.
  • Strong knowledge of gender mainstreaming, social inclusion, and disability-inclusive development approaches.
  • Experience working with government institutions, NGOs, civil society organizations, and community-based organisations.
  • Experience designing and facilitating training, mentorship, and capacity-strengthening initiatives.
  • Excellent communication, stakeholder engagement, and relationship management skills.
  • Fluency in English.

Desirable

  • Additional training or certification in Sexual and Reproductive Health and Rights (SRHR), Youth Programming, Disability Inclusion, or Gender Equality and Social Inclusion.

What We Offer

  • An opportunity to contribute to transformational programmes that improve the lives of young people and vulnerable populations.
  • A dynamic and inclusive work environment.
  • Professional growth and development opportunities.
  • The chance to work with a team committed to reproductive health, rights, and social inclusion.

Marie Stopes Zambia is an equal opportunity employer and is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of all individuals. We maintain a zero-tolerance approach to fraud, bribery, and child abuse.
